Peas, Pasta and a Red Pepper Vinaigrette Salad
 
recipe image
Prep Time: 15 Minutes
Cook Time: 25 Minutes
Ready In: 40 Minutes
Servings: 8
Light, simple, fresh summer flavors, market ingredients, easy and quick and travels and keeps great for BBQ's
Ingredients:
3/4 lb small shell pasta (i like small shells, ditalini or anything small in shape. rotini, spirals, and penne is too big to m)
1/2 lb snow peas (ends trimmed and cut in half on an angle)
3/4 lb frozen baby peas (thawed)
3 shallots, thin sliced
1 cup roasted red pepper vinaigrette
2 tablespoons chives, chopped fine
salt
pepper
1 (7 ounce) jar roasted red peppers (most jars are about 7 oz, if you want to make your own, approximately 1 large bell pepper roasted pe)
1 1/2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ar (you can substitute red wine if you want, it changes the flavor a bit but it will work just fine)
1 teaspoon garlic, minced
2 tablespoons shallots, minced
4 tablespoons olive oil
1 teaspoon honey
1 pinch red pepper flakes (optional)
salt
pepper
grated parmesan cheese
Directions:
1. Peas - Mix the shallots and baby peas in a large bowl, salt and pepper and just let them hang out.
2. Pasta - Cook the pasta according to directions. The last minute add the snow peas in to blanch. After 1 minute, drain and cool.
3. Finish - Add the baby peas and shallots to the drained pasta and top with the vinaigrette and chives. It is that easy. Top with some grated parmesan if you like for a crisp fresh salad.
